amai-tari is an open-source library that enables behavioral tracing and conduct scoring for AI agents. It provides local, private observability without exposing content, helping developers monitor agent actions and ensure responsible AI behavior. Designed for AI developers and researchers, it integrates with tools like OpenTelemetry and supports MCP.
In the LLM eval & observability space, amai-tari takes a focused approach. It focuses on understanding and monitoring the behavior of AI agents without exposing content, ensuring privacy and security. It is built as an open-source project for AI developers and researchers. amai-tari is open source under the Apache-2.0 license. amai-tari is available on the command line and API, and it can be self-hosted.
amai-tari first shipped in 2026. Key capabilities include behavioral tracing, conduct scoring, and local observability. It exposes integrations via an MCP server and a public API.
